Plasma Cell Dyscrasias Case Conference 2019-2021


RSSCMECNESafetyPSRM - Patient Safety/Risk Management

  • Overview
  • Schedule
  • Faculty
Add to Calendar Plasma Cell Dyscrasias Case Conference 2019-2021 7/12/2019 12:00:00 PM 7/12/2019 1:00:00 PM America/New_York For More Details: https://upenn.cloud-cme.com/course/courseoverview?EID=60920 Description: Case review to enhance understanding of diagnosis, prognosis and treatment of plasma cell dyscrasias Perelman Center for Advanced Medicine, 12 SPE 122 false MM/DD/YYYY


Occurs every 2 weeks on Friday starting on 7/12/2019 at 12:00 PM
Friday, July 12, 2019, 12:00 PM - 1:00 PM, Perelman Center for Advanced Medicine, 12 SPE 122


Case review to enhance understanding of diagnosis, prognosis and treatment of plasma cell dyscrasias


Specialties - INTERNAL MEDICINE - Hematology, INTERNAL MEDICINE - Medical Oncology, PATHOLOGY - CLINICAL


Objectives
  1. Diagnose various plasma cell dyscrasias and distinguish between pre-cancerous (MGUS/smoldering) and malignant (multiple myeloma) conditions.
  2. Discuss standard-of-care treatment for patients with plasma cell dyscrasias and harmonize practice patterns.
  3. Incorporate recently published/presented research and practice guidelines into local practice and pathways.


In support of improving patient care, Penn Medicine is jointly accredited by the Accreditation Council for Continuing Medical Education (ACCME), the Accreditation Council for Pharmacy Education (ACPE), and the American Nurses Credentialing Center (ANCC), to provide continuing education for the healthcare team.  

Designation of Credit



AMA PRA Category 1 Credits™ (1.00 hours), NCPD Hours (ANCC) (1.00 hours), Non-Physician Attendance / Participation (1.00 hours), Patient Safety/Risk Management PSRM (1.00 hours)
